Step into the world of gin making at the York Distillery's Gin School, where you'll craft your very own unique bottle of gin. The experience kicks off with a refreshing York Gin G&T, followed by a mini tasting of gins, plus an exploration of a range of botanicals to discover your favourite flavours.

Guided by WSET-qualified gin tutors, you'll learn the art of distillation and the fascinating history of gin. As you create your spirit, you'll learn more about the fun and dark history of this most interesting of spirits.

Take home your bespoke 700ml bottle of gin and the knowledge to appreciate gins like never before.

With a York Gin gin and tonic in hand, we’ll give you an insight into how we started, show you our full production still and explain our production process to give you a feel for distillation.

We’ll then take you on a guided tasting of our core gins to help you understand your palette, discover the styles of gin you prefer and also your favourite botanicals.

You’re then ready to learn the art of distilling gin. Guided through choosing your own botanicals, weighing each of them and distilling your own unique bottle to take home in a beautiful copper still.
